According to Massachusetts and Federal laws, individuals with disabilities are protected from being discriminated against in the workplace. The various laws ensure that disabled individuals in Somerville have an equal opportunity to get hired and obtain promotions in their choice of field. Employers must provide disabled persons with reasonable accomodations under these disbility laws so that they are able to perform their jobs.
Massachusetts Employment for the Disabled
Whether you are employed by a government agency or a private company, the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A) prohibits discrimination against the disabled. When making decisions regarding hiring, job assignment, or promotions, employers in Massachusetts cannot consider a person's disability.
As long as the costs are reasonable, Somerville employers are required to provide workers who have disabilities with any special equipment they require for completing tasks. Additionally, the ADA makes it illegal to discriminate against someone based on their relationship to persons who have a disability requiring special needs.
